The primary function of the Office Coordinator is to ensure a seamless, professional, and welcoming office experience by managing daily operations, supporting employees, and delivering exceptional guest service. The Office Coordinator is the first point of contact at the front desk, but the role is expected to operate at a higher standard than a traditional receptionist position — anticipating needs, owning follow-through, and keeping the office consistently guest-ready. The ideal candidate is organized, proactive, and service-oriented, with a calm, professional presence.

Responsibilities

  • Maintain a consistent and dependable schedule that ensures all administrative functions and areas run efficiently and the office always remains guest-ready
  • Serve as the primary point of contact at the front desk, creating a welcoming environment for all visitors and employees from the moment they enter and addressing all visitor inquiries, phone calls, and internal requests in a timely and professional manner
  • Manage office and breakroom supplies, including mini-mart inventory, restrooms, and media rooms; communicate and maintain relationships with office vendors, placing orders for the office and various jobsites, and addressing cross-department needs
  • Provide administrative support, including managing conference room calendars, coordinating meeting setups, booking travel arrangements, maintaining filing systems, and handling mailing/shipping needs
  • Oversee office readiness and space needs, including resetting conference rooms between meetings, restocking breakrooms and media rooms throughout the day, and flagging facilities needs as they arise
  • Manage the flow of mail, including receiving, sorting, and distributing incoming deliveries each morning, as well as preparing and handling outgoing mail and shipping
  • Implement and maintain office procedures, checklists, and administrative protocols — including Guru process documentation — to enhance organizational efficiency
  • Provide administrative support to office leadership and teams, including coordinating schedules, lunches, huddles, and correspondence to keep day-to-day operations running smoothly
  • Anticipate the needs of guests, employees, and leadership, proactively addressing gaps before they arise and confirming completion of every request
  • Assist in planning and executing office events, employee engagement activities, and culture initiatives
  • Participating in special projects and other duties as assigned, supporting broader office and team priorities
